Quick Summary

The Bureau of Land Management (BLM), Nevada State Office, is soliciting proposals for Annual Fire Extinguisher Service at various BLM locations in Carson City, Nevada. This unrestricted opportunity seeks a contractor to provide inspection, servicing, and maintenance for fire extinguishers. Quotes are due June 10, 2026, at 12:00 PM PT.

Scope of Work

The contractor will provide comprehensive inspection, servicing, repair, and recharging of fire extinguishers across multiple facilities, including the Carson City District Office, Palomino Fire Station, Stead Air Tanker Base, Silver State Hotshots Operation Center, and Cold Springs Fire Station. Services must comply with NFPA 10, NFPA 25, and other federal, state, and local requirements. The contractor is responsible for all labor, equipment, supplies, mileage, and materials. Specific tasks include internal component inspection, agent replacement/recharging, and hydro-testing as needed. A detailed spreadsheet of serviced extinguishers must be submitted.
